Lakhs of engineering aspirants endeavour to seek admission in various M. Tech programmes at the popular Indian Institute of Technology or IIT BHU in Varanasi. The college was previously known as the Banaras Hindu University Institute of Technology. While many students go for IIT BHU M. Tech admissions via GATE or Graduate Aptitude Test in Engineering, the institute also accommodates sponsored candidates from industries, research and development organisations, and academic institutions. IIT BHU Eligibility Criteria for M.Tech Programmes
If you want to know who can apply for IIT BHU M.Tech admissions, then check out the following basic eligibility criteria the institution has set. Please note that several departments at IIT BHU may have further criteria to select and admit students.
• A Bachelor’s degree in engineering or technology in an apt discipline
• A valid GATE score – The criterion is not applicable to engineering and technology graduates from IITs with a minimum CGPA of 8.0.

• Written Test and/or Interview:
Based on the academic credentials and GATE scores of candidates, IIT BHU invites some chosen aspirants to a written test and/or interview. While 70% weightage is given to the GATE scores of candidates, the rest 30% weightage goes to their performance in the written test or interview. However, there is a minimum pass percentage in the test/interview. While this is the usual selection criteria as per the Ministry of HRD guidelines, any unexpected change cannot be ruled out. How to Apply for M.Tech at IIT BHU
All candidates willing to go for IIT BHU M.Tech admissions should follow the below-mentioned procedure of application:
• Register on the official portal of IIT BHU (iitbhu.ac.in) by providing the required information, such as your name and the names of your father and mother, as well as your gender, category, nationality, DOB, address, cell phone number, and email ID.
• Use your registration ID and password to log into the portal. You will get these details on your registered email ID after you register on the portal.
• Fill up the M. Tech admission application form on the portal and upload all the required documents or certificates.
• Upload a recent photograph of yours, as well as your signature. The size of both these documents has to be less than 50 KB.
• Make the application fee payment now through the link to the SBI Collect Portal.
• This completes your application procedure. You do not need to send a hard copy of your application to the institute authorities.
Application Fee Payable for an M.Tech Programme
Following is the application fee that you need to pay while filling up the application form for IIT BHU M.Tech admission.
• For candidates of General/OBC/PC categories: INR 500
• For candidates of SC/ST categories: INR 250
The fee is payable through the online mode via the link given on the portal during application form filling.
